C0201
Brake Fluid Level Switch Circuit
The ABS or brake control module has detected a fault in the brake fluid level switch circuit. A low fluid level indicates a potential leak in the hydraulic system and disables ABS while a separate brake warning lamp is illuminated.

Possible causes
- Brake fluid level low (worn pads or hydraulic leak) high
- Float switch in reservoir failed medium
- Wiring or connector fault low
Symptoms
- ABS warning light on
- ESC/stability control deactivated
- Possible reduced brake assist
- Speedometer may behave erratically
